Многие владельцы умных телевизоров и ТВ-приставок на базе Android TV внезапно сталкиваются с пугающим системным сообщением: «В работе приложения произошел сбой tvapi service». Этот системный процесс отвечает за базовую коммуникацию между операционной системой, аппаратными компонентами и установленными медиа-приложениями.
Игнорирование данной ошибки может привести к полной неработоспособности интерфейса, зависанию пульта или невозможности запустить онлайн-кинотеатры. Сбой tvapi service часто свидетельствует о конфликте версий программного обеспечения или повреждении временных файлов системы.
В этом материале мы детально разберем механизмы возникновения ошибки, проведем диагностику и предложим проверенные методы восстановления стабильной работы вашего устройства без обращения в сервисный центр.
Что такое tvapi service и почему он важен для Android TV
Процесс tvapi service является скрытым системным компонентом, который служит мостом между аппаратной частью устройства и программным обеспечением. Он управляет запросами от приложений к «железу» телевизора, обеспечивая корректную обработку сигналов и вывод изображения.
Когда вы видите уведомление о сбое, это означает, что фоновый процесс попытался выполнить действие, но столкнулся с препятствием. Это может быть нехватка оперативной памяти, повреждение кэша или конфликт с недавно установленным обновлением операционной системы.
Важно понимать, что это не вирус, а штатная, но поврежденная функция системы. Критическим моментом является то, что сбой tvapi service часто предшествует циклической перезагрузке устройства (bootloop), если не принять меры вовремя. Система пытается перезапустить службу, терпит неудачу и выдает ошибку пользователю.
Специфика работы Android TV такова, что множество приложений постоянно обращаются к этому сервису. Если одно из них «зависло» или потребовало недоступного ресурса, возникает каскадная реакция, блокирующая работу всего интерфейса.
Если ошибка появляется сразу после включения телевизора, попробуйте отключить устройство от электросети на 2-3 минуты — это поможет сбросить остаточный заряд и очистить оперативную память.
Основные причины возникновения системного сбоя
Существует несколько ключевых факторов, провоцирующих появление сообщения о сбое. Чаще всего проблема кроется в программном обеспечении, а не в физической поломке матрицы или процессора.
Первой и самой распространенной причиной является неудачное обновление. Если процесс установки новой версии Android TV был прерван или файл был поврежден при загрузке, системные библиотеки могут работать некорректно. Конфликт версий между прошивкой и встроенными приложениями также играет не последнюю роль.
Второй фактор — переполнение кэша. Временные файлы, накапливающиеся в процессе использования Smart TV, со временем могут повредиться. Когда tvapi service пытается обратиться к битому файлу, происходит аварийное завершение процесса.
Третья причина — стороннее программное обеспечение. Установка приложений из неизвестных источников (не из Google Play Market) часто приводит к внедрению кода, который нарушает стабильность системных служб.
- 📉 Повреждение системных файлов после скачка напряжения или резкого отключения питания.
- 📦 Конфликт между старой версией прошивки и новыми версиями приложений (YouTube, Netflix, Кинопоиск).
- 🔌 Нестабильное интернет-соединение, прерывающее работу фоновых служб синхронизации.
- 🧠 Нехватка свободной внутренней памяти для работы операционной системы.
- Только после обновления системы
- Постоянно при запуске приложений
- Редко, раз в несколько месяцев
- Никогда не сталкивался
Первичная диагностика и быстрые решения
Прежде чем переходить к сложным манипуляциям, необходимо выполнить базовую диагностику. Часто проблема решается простой перезагрузкой, которая очищает временные буферы памяти.
Выполните полную перезагрузку устройства, отключив его от розетки. Не ограничивайтесь выключением пультом, так как многие телевизоры в этом режиме не обесточиваются полностью, а переходят в режим ожидания. Вам нужно физически выдернуть шнур питания на 60 секунд.
Проверьте свободное место в памяти. Зайдите в настройки хранилища и убедитесь, что свободно хотя бы 15-20% от общего объема. Переполненная память — частая причина, по которой tvapi service не может создать необходимые временные файлы.
Также стоит проверить дату и время. Неверные системные часы могут нарушать работу сертификатов безопасности, что вызывает сбои при попытке сервисов соединиться с серверами.
☑️ Первичная диагностика
Метод очистки кэша и данных системных приложений
Если простая перезагрузка не помогла, необходимо принудительно очистить данные проблемного компонента. Это безопасная операция, которая не удалит ваши личные файлы, но сбросит настройки приложений до заводских.
Для этого перейдите в меню Настройки → Приложения → Все приложения. Найдите в списке «TV Input Framework», «Android TV Core Services» или непосредственно «tvapi service» (название может варьироваться в зависимости от версии Android).
Выберите нужный пункт и нажмите «Очистить кэш», а затем «Очистить данные». После этого система может попросить подтвердить действие. Согласитесь и перезагрузите устройство.
⚠️ Внимание: Очистка данных системных приложений сбросит ваши персонализации в меню (расположение плиток, входы HDMI). Будьте готовы заново настроить главный экран.
Особое внимание уделите приложению Google Play Services for TV. Его некорректная работа часто маскируется под сбой tvapi. Очистка кэша этого сервиса решает проблему в 80% случаев.
Что делать, если меню настроек недоступно?
Если интерфейс заблокирован ошибкой и не дает войти в настройки, попробуйте запустить приложение «TV Remote» на смартфоне (официальное от Google или производителя ТВ). Через телефон иногда удается попасть в меню настроек, минуя блокировку на экране телевизора.
Обновление и перепрошивка операционной системы
Устаревшее программное обеспечение — враг стабильности. Производители регулярно выпускают патчи, исправляющие ошибки в коде tvapi service. Проверьте наличие обновлений в разделе Настройки → Система → О телевизоре → Обновление системы.
Если автоматическое обновление не работает или зависает, можно попробовать метод ручной установки. Найдите на официальном сайте производителя прошивку, точно соответствующую вашей модели (серийный номер и ревизия платы должны совпадать).
Скопируйте файл прошивки на USB-накопитель (форматированный в FAT32). Вставьте флешку в выключенный телевизор. Зажмите кнопку питания на корпусе ТВ (не на пульте) и подключите шнур питания. Устройство должно перейти в режим восстановления и предложить обновиться.
| Метод обновления | Сложность | Риски | Эффективность |
|---|---|---|---|
| Автоматическое (OTA) | Низкая | Минимальные | Средняя |
| Через USB (Manual) | Средняя | Средние (нужна точная модель) | Высокая |
| Через ADB (Debug) | Высокая | Высокие (для профи) | Максимальная |
| Сброс до заводских | Низкая | Потеря данных | Высокая |
Используйте только официальные прошивки с сайта производителя. Установка ПО от другой модели или региона может навсегда вывести материнскую плату из строя.
Сброс до заводских настроек как радикальное решение
Когда программные ошибки становятся критическими и никакие методы очистки не помогают, остается последний программный аргумент — полный сброс (Hard Reset). Эта процедура вернет телевизор к состоянию «из коробки».
Выполнить сброс можно через меню: Настройки → Система → Сброс. Если меню недоступно, используйте комбинацию кнопок на корпусе. Обычно это зажатие кнопки «Power» и «Volume Down» одновременно при подключении питания.
После сброса телевизор будет долго загружаться (до 10-15 минут). Не прерывайте этот процесс. После первоначальной настройки проверьте, исчезла ли ошибка tvapi service.
⚠️ Внимание: Полный сброс безвозвратно удаляет все установленные приложения, аккаунты Google, сохраненные пароли Wi-Fi и настройки изображения. Заранее запишите важные данные.
Если даже после полного сброса ошибка появляется на этапе первоначальной настройки, это с высокой долей вероятности указывает на аппаратную неисправность flash-памяти или процессора.
Аппаратные проблемы и когда нужен мастер
В некоторых случаях программные методы бессильны. Если чип памяти eMMC имеет физические дефекты («битые» сектора), система не сможет корректно записывать файлы, необходимые для работы tvapi service.
Также проблема может крыться в перегреве процессора. Если системе охлаждения (радиатору или термопасте) требуется обслуживание, процессор начинает работать с ошибками при повышении температуры, что вызывает системные сбои.
Проверьте блок питания. Нестабильное напряжение может приводить к кратковременным просадкам мощности, достаточным для сбоя процессора, но недостаточным для полного выключения экрана.
- 🔥 Появление ошибки сопровождается сильным нагревом нижней части корпуса телевизора.
- 📺 Искажение изображения или артефакты на экране перед появлением сообщения о сбое.
- 🔊 Характерный треск или щелчки из блока питания при включении.
- 🔄 Телевизор уходит в циклическую перезагрузку (bootloop) сразу после логотипа бренда.
Можно ли исправить память программно?
Существуют методы перепрошивки дампа памяти через UART-программатор, но это требует разборки телевизора, пайки и наличия специального оборудования. В домашних условиях это сделать невозможно.
Часто задаваемые вопросы (FAQ)
Можно ли полностью удалить tvapi service?
Нет, это системный компонент, необходимый для работы операционной системы Android TV. Его удаление или блокировка приведут к неработоспособности интерфейса и невозможности запуска любых приложений.
Влияет ли скорость интернета на появление этой ошибки?
Косвенно — да. Если соединение нестабильно, сервис может не успеть получить ответ от сервера в отведенное время (timeout), что система интерпретирует как сбой приложения. Однако низкая скорость сама по себе редко является единственной причиной.
Поможет ли установка стороннего лаунчера?
Установка альтернативного лаунчера (например, ATV Launcher) может снизить нагрузку на стандартный интерфейс и обойти баги штатной оболочки, но не исправит саму ошибку в системном сервисе. Это временное решение.
Сколько времени занимает полный сброс системы?
Процесс форматирования и переустановки занимает от 5 до 20 минут в зависимости от объема внутренней памяти и скорости процессора вашего Smart TV. Главное — не выключать питание в этот период.